This is the beginning of a current article in Scientific American…
“From World War II until 2024, the US stood unchallenged as the scientific leader of the free world. Across practically every discipline — physics, materials science, astronomy, chemistry, biology, medicine, geology, etc. — American scientific missions and initiatives, often in collaboration with European, Canadian, Asian, and many other global partners, brought us new advances and breakthroughs, paving the way for generations of scientists to thrive. In a society that values facts, scientific truths, education, and the public good, this recipe led to multiple generations of continued breakthroughs and advances.
Since late January of this year, however, all of that has rapidly changed. Many of the most valuable scientific organizations in the world, including NOAA, NASA, the NSF, the CDC, the EPA, and the FDA, have experienced a set of unprecedented internal attacks.Funding streams have been terminated.
Grants that have been successfully competed for and won have been pulled.
Fellowships and scholarships have been revoked.
Contracts have been broken.
Thousands upon thousands of employees have been terminated, often in defiance of court orders.And now, at the start of the second half of 2025, a new budget is on the verge of becoming law, which would largely eliminate science as we know it across universities and colleges, research institutes, and national labs. This isn’t a horror story; this is a real-life nightmare for the most educated and skilled American workers of all: scientists.”

My wife and I attended the “No Kings” protest in Kent today. Nice turnout, great vibe, it felt good. I saw quite a few veterans there as well as other folks you wouldn’t expect to see at a protest. I saw two people with a sign that read something to the effect of “I have too many reasons to be here to list on this sign”. I only saw one really vulgar sign that contained the “F” word. Most of the rest were clever or just sincere. One veteran carried a sign that read “My oath did not expire. I’m still defending the constitution” which I thought was nice.
